Research focus
  • Land use and its effect on biodiversity : assessment of ecosystem health
  • Environmental Impact assessment of various enterprises in the built environment and development projects.
  • Land degradation and desertification and livelihood adaptations in arid and semi arid areas
  • Environmental monitoring as a tool to maintain human health and the quality of life.
  • Design of rehabilitative innovations to reduce negative effects of development process (industry, construction, agriculture etc.) on the environment.
  • Resource use conflicts and conflict resolution
  • The role of resource use in Ecosystem dynamics and equilibrium
  • Action research on Ecosystem modification and effects on livelihoods
  • Effects of Land Degradation/Climate change and Community livelihoods
  • Environmental Education and Education of Sustainable Development
